Output 77ba8de9ccd362057569767f8d058bb86b442998ca334a10e9d61d37ced99b2a:8

value
17917371
script pubkey
OP_0 OP_PUSHBYTES_20 d8d37a831ef81baf1677ada6dd2197d06e8ea405
address
bc1qmrfh4qc7lqd679nh4knd6gvh6phgafq989gjxz
transaction
77ba8de9ccd362057569767f8d058bb86b442998ca334a10e9d61d37ced99b2a
spent
true